RECOMMENDATION:

Approve award and authorize Interim Executive Director to execute contract and associated disbursements with All Weather Waterproofing Inc. to replace roofs at Timpanogos, Warm Springs, and Midvale Rail Service Center in the amount of $557,475.

BACKGROUND:

The roofs at these three locations have exceeded their life expectancy and need to be replaced. These roofs have deteriorated to a point where repair is no longer practical or fiscally responsible. The procurement was advertised as an Invitation for bid (IFB) with All Weather Waterproofing Inc. winning the bid as the low bidder at $557,475.

DISCUSSION:

UTA staff is requesting approval of a contract to replace roofs at Timpanogos, Warm Springs, and Midvale Rail Service Center with All Weather Waterproofing Inc. in the amount of $557,475.  The scope of the contract includes removing the existing roofs and replacing them with a .60 mil Thermoplastic Polyolefin (TPO) roof with a 20-year warranty.  The replaced roofs will be completed in a manner that will not interfere with operations or hinder any future expansions to the existing buildings. The roof replacements have been identified as 2022 state of good repair projects in accordance with the UTA Transit Asset Management (TAM) Plan and are funded in the 2022 budget.  The price is deemed fair and reasonable because of the competitive nature of the procurement.

ALTERNATIVES:

There are no feasible alternatives. Waiting to replace or continuing to repair the existing roofs will cause damage to the building’s infrastructures and will also create safety and slip hazards.

FISCAL IMPACT:

Funds are budgeted into the 2022 Facilities Managed Reserve account.
